It’s because you’re using an incompatible version of gracenotes. The one you’re trying to use is for the newer gen Mazdas. Your gracenote version was updated to the latest version when you updated the firmware to 74.00.324 (which includes an update to gracenotes version 00.12.003)...

Another PSA. Please uninstall AIO if you installed it before trying to update.
Spent 28 direct messages back and forth troubleshooting with a member because they failed to tell me they installed AIO and they broke their failsafe and couldn’t install.
Once they uninstalled AIO, it worked...
